Senior Planner
DISTINGUISHING FEATURES OF THE CLASS: This is a senior level supervisory position involving responsibility for program development and planning, assigning, supervising, reviewing, coordinating and undertaking a variety of complex assignments. This position reports directly to and works under the general supervision of members of the Towns leadership team with wide latitude allowed to exercise independence in performing the work. This position has supervision over Planners, Planning Technicians, and/or clerical employees.
TYPICAL WORK ACTIVITIES: Compiles and analyzes data and undertakes research on physical, social and economic problems related to community planning; Develops and administers special county planning programs; Reviews zoning, subdivision and other development proposals; Prepares local master plans, zoning ordinances and subdivision regulations; Prepares elements of the county comprehensive development plan; Reviews plans, programs and capital improvement project proposals by public agencies which effect the development of the county or town; Prepare and review New York State Environmental Quality Review (SEQRA) documents; Provides staff support for public participation activities; Prepares components of the county or town capital improvement program; Prepares proposed legislation related to plan implementation and other related written communication; Assigns and supervises related planning tasks and research; Prepares and administers consultant contracts; Prepares tentative budget estimates and assists in maintaining budgetary control; Coordinates departmental activities with other public agencies; Assists in the training of professional and technical personnel; Represents the department before legislative committees, town boards, other governmental groups and the general public.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: EITHER: (A) Graduation from a regionally accredited or New York State registered college or university with a Bachelors degree in urban planning, economics, geography, environmental planning, environmental science, geology, sociology, political science, public administration, landscape architecture, or civil engineering, plus four (4) years paid full time or its part time equivalent experience in various aspects of the planning field including housing, transportation, land use or environmental planning, comprehensive planning, human resource planning, economic planning, planning policy analysis, preparing land use regulations, zoning administration, or site design and a minimum of two (2) years of leadership and management; OR, (B) Graduation from a regionally accredited or New York State registered college or university with a Master's degree in urban planning, economics, geography, environmental planning, environmental sciences, geology, sociology, political science, public administration, landscape architecture, civil engineering, or a closely related field, plus three (3) years of professional planning experience as defined in (A) and a minimum of two (2) years of leadership and management.
